Arson suspected in Kapalama house fire

Police have initiated an arson investigation after the Honolulu Fire Department determined a residential fire in Kapalama was intentionally set.

At 12:46 p.m. Tuesday, firefighters responded to a two-alarm fire at 1218 Alani Street. Police said the fire broke out within the first level of the two-story home while two women were at home.

One of the two residents, 20, who was inside the first level climbed out of a window.

Honolulu Fire Capt. David Jenkins said both residents were able to escape without injury.

Firefighters brought the fire under control shortly before 1 p.m. and extinguished it by 1:12 p.m.

Damage was estimated at $6,000 to the structure and its contents.
